Welcome to on-call for the Glimmerpane design system! Our snapshot tests live in the `snapcheck` suite and run on every merge to main. If a UI component changes visually, the diff bot flags it — usually it's an intentional tweak, so just approve the new baseline. If it's 2am and snapshots are failing across the board, it's almost always a font-loading race, not your problem. To unlock the baseline store and re-approve snapshots in bulk, use the recovery passphrase below.

recovery phrase for tahag-taguf: wenix-caswyn

Internal Memo — Support Outsourcing Plan

To all branch managers: we are evaluating a phased transfer of tier-one customer support to Harbenfield Services, beginning with the Westmoor region. Current staff will be offered retraining into tier-two roles; no involuntary reductions are planned in phase one. Service-level targets remain unchanged, and escalation paths stay in-house. Please route questions through your regional lead rather than to staff directly. One strategic detail follows below.

board note of tadup-tajog: Headcount on the Oliiel team goes from 31 to 88 by the end of February. Gross margin on Oliiel came in at 62 percent against a plan of 29 percent.

## v4.2.0 — Changed Defaults

The order-cutoff rule for Ovenlark bakery tenants now defaults to 18:00 local rather than midnight. Orders placed after cutoff roll to the next production day automatically; no manual queue sweep needed. Tenants with explicit overrides are unaffected. The grace window for in-flight carts was shortened and weekend cutoffs now apply uniformly. Release managers: confirm downstream forecasting jobs pick up the new defaults before the Friday batch. The new default configuration values are as follows.

deployment values, tafof-taduf:
pelius:
  pin: 6508
  tenant: praiel
  seal: seal_4e33a2f4
  metrics_host: metrics.pelius.plorvagrid.corp
  standby_team: druix
  escalation: juldor-norius
  nonce: 5db598